Transaction 3db64bfb70742c9ea4a6c217c97f3edffee2424a5b3ff85461ad434fc12d4f51
1 Input
1 Output
-
3db64bfb70742c9ea4a6c217c97f3edffee2424a5b3ff85461ad434fc12d4f51:0
- value
- 742635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e348fc7ec7c409f0104f5b989136d152bdda9459 OP_EQUAL
- address
- 3NQnkGSGPJ81ke8bRNuriAjByCknDFLkDB